Subject: [PATCH 03/23] builtin-remote: teach show to display remote HEAD
Date: Tue, 24 Feb 2009 04:50:51 -0500 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<41dd1de0e111b3f135a061848d1e92d9b7994623.1235467368.git.jaysoffian@gmail.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<cover.1235467368.git.jaysoffian@gmail.com>
This is in preparation for teaching remote how to set
refs/remotes/<remote>/HEAD to match what HEAD is set to at <remote>, but
is useful in its own right.
Signed-off-by: Jay Soffian <jaysoffian@gmail.com>
---
builtin-remote.c | 26 ++++++++++++++++++++++++++
t/t5505-remote.sh | 3 ++-
2 files changed, 28 insertions(+), 1 deletions(-)
diff --git a/builtin-remote.c b/builtin-remote.c
index b89a353..465c87a 100644
--- a/builtin-remote.c
+++ b/builtin-remote.c
@@ -212,6 +212,7 @@ static void read_branches(void)
struct ref_states {
struct remote *remote;
struct string_list new, stale, tracked;
+ char *head_name;
};
static int handle_one_branch(const char *refname,
@@ -271,6 +272,26 @@ static int get_ref_states(const struct ref *ref, struct ref_states *states)
return 0;
}
+static char *get_head_name(const struct ref *refs)
+{
+ const struct ref *head_points_at;
+ struct ref *mapped_refs = NULL;
+ struct ref **tail = &mapped_refs;
+ struct refspec refspec;
+
+ refspec.force = 0;
+ refspec.pattern = 1;
+ refspec.src = refspec.dst = "refs/heads/";
+
+ get_fetch_map(refs, &refspec, &tail, 0);
+
+ head_points_at = guess_remote_head(refs, mapped_refs, NULL);
+ if (head_points_at)
+ return xstrdup(abbrev_branch(head_points_at->name));
+
+ return NULL;
+}
+
struct known_remote {
struct known_remote *next;
struct remote *remote;
@@ -637,6 +658,7 @@ static void free_remote_ref_states(struct ref_states *states)
string_list_clear(&states->new, 0);
string_list_clear(&states->stale, 0);
string_list_clear(&states->tracked, 0);
+ free(states->head_name);
}
static int get_remote_ref_states(const char *name,
@@ -658,6 +680,7 @@ static int get_remote_ref_states(const char *name,
ref = transport_get_remote_refs(transport);
transport_disconnect(transport);
+ states->head_name = get_head_name(ref);
get_ref_states(ref, states);
}
@@ -702,6 +725,9 @@ static int show(int argc, const char **argv)
printf("* remote %s\n URL: %s\n", *argv,
states.remote->url_nr > 0 ?
states.remote->url[0] : "(no URL)");
+ if (!no_query)
+ printf(" HEAD: %s\n", states.head_name ?
+ states.head_name : "(unknown)");
for (i = 0; i < branch_list.nr; i++) {
struct string_list_item *branch = branch_list.items + i;
diff --git a/t/t5505-remote.sh b/t/t5505-remote.sh
index eb63718..826d0c3 100755
--- a/t/t5505-remote.sh
+++ b/t/t5505-remote.sh
@@ -136,6 +136,7 @@ EOF
cat > test/expect << EOF
* remote origin
URL: $(pwd)/one
+ HEAD: master
Remote branch merged with 'git pull' while on branch master
master
New remote branch (next fetch will store in remotes/origin)
@@ -343,7 +344,7 @@ test_expect_success '"remote show" does not show symbolic refs' '
git clone one three &&
(cd three &&
git remote show origin > output &&
- ! grep HEAD < output &&
+ ! grep "^ *HEAD$" < output &&
! grep -i stale < output)
'
